Transaction 71159bbddf4a4302a77af3dd88b87016b6d6b89fd382660325dd6bf963812778
1 Input
1 Output
-
71159bbddf4a4302a77af3dd88b87016b6d6b89fd382660325dd6bf963812778:0
- value
- 2408194
- script pubkey
- OP_0 OP_PUSHBYTES_32 a4d3cb81e123f62ff8a717197fe8025087c07c6c4a8ea009b7d22614a655c8ff
- address
- bc1q5nfuhq0py0mzl798zuvhl6qz2zruqlrvf282qzdh6gnpffj4erls0hk0da